Project Daan – Saving Non-Productive Cows from Slaughter
“A Cow is Not a Commodity, She is a Life to be Honored”
Introduction
Across India, thousands of aging or non-milking cows are abandoned or sold to slaughterhouses every year. Once they stop producing milk, they are deemed economically unviable by many owners.
Project Daan by Tirupati Balaji Green Frontiers (TBGF) is a humanitarian and cultural response to this crisis. We believe that cows, irrespective of their productivity, deserve respect, nourishment, and protection.
Project Daan aims to save such cattle by supporting gaushalas (cow shelters), ensuring regular feeding, and encouraging sustainable cow protection practices.
Why Your Support is Needed
- Non-milking cows are often left abandoned or sold to slaughterhouses.
- Many gaushalas lack resources to feed and care for aging or unproductive cattle.
- Cow dung from these cattle can be repurposed for organic manure, biogas, and eco-products.
- With public support, these cows can live out their natural lives with dignity.
How You Can Help: The Process
- Choose a donation scheme (see below) to sponsor cow feed or rescue efforts.
- TBGF coordinates with registered gaushalas to identify non-milking cows in need.
- We supply free cattle feed to gaushalas that agree to protect such cows.
- In return, gaushalas will provide cow dung to TBGF at zero cost or subsidized rates.
- Alternatively, donors can support us directly to purchase cow dung, and we will reinvest proceeds into free cattle feed distribution.
